Full job description

Job Summary

Distribution Systems Support Team Members provide support to various areas of distribution operations. This includes shipping, receiving and inventory control. Job Description

  • Experience Required: 0 to 6 months
  • Education Desired: High school diploma or equivalent
  • Lifting Requirement: Up to 50 pounds
  • Travel Required: None
  • Age Requirement: At least 18 years of age

Job Responsibilities

  • Enter verifications into the system in a timely manner.
  • Follow all applicable safety and sanitation procedures.
  • Enter identification numbers of processed purchase orders into scheduling database.
  • Have flexibility in scheduling and availability to work the times, shifts, days and overtime as necessary.
  • Deliver unparalleled customer service.
  • Complete all assignments in a timely manner including cycle counts, audits and /or research discrepancies.
  • Maintain tracking, reporting and filing systems.
  • Audit outbound orders.
  • Review batching information to verify shipping sequences.
  • Monitor drops to ensure the customer receives the product ordered.
  • Perform all aspects of the reset area including scanning and palletizing the product to processing damages.
  • Maintain counts and monitor pallet needs for distribution center and communicate requirements jot supervision.
  • Assist operations in monitoring voice selection to ensure drops/resets are completed for load departure.
  • Flexibility in scheduling with the availability to work all shifts, weekends, holidays and overtime.
  • Coordinate training of new personnel, as well as cross training of current staff.
  • Perform other miscellaneous duties and special projects.
  • HBC: Perform all aspects of the cigarette machine
  • FFM: Work in a freezer warehouse environment with daily exposure to temperatures ranging from zero to -10 degrees Fahrenheit
